The Basics of Refresh Rates
Refresh rate refers to the number of times per second that a display updates its image. Measured in hertz (Hz), this specification directly influences how smooth and responsive the graphics appear during use. For VR, high refresh rates are critical due to the following reasons:
- Fluid Motion: Higher refresh rates reduce blurring and enhance the clarity of fast-moving objects, creating a sensation of realism.
- Reduced Motion Sickness: Refresh rates above 90Hz can significantly decrease the likelihood of motion sickness, which is a common issue in VR environments.

Step 1: Check Device Compatibility
Before you enable 120Hz, confirm whether your Oculus headset supports it. Here’s a quick overview:
Oculus Devices | 120Hz Support |
---|---|
Oculus Quest 2 | Yes |
Oculus Rift S | No |
Oculus Quest | No |
If you own an Oculus Quest 2, you’re in luck! This headset supports 120Hz mode, but you need to ensure that your software is up to date.

Choosing the Right Content
Not every game or application will run at 120Hz. Therefore, it’s essential to select titles that support higher refresh rates for a better experience. Check in the Oculus Store or the game’s specifications for 120Hz compatibility.
Optimize Your Hardware Setup
For optimal performance when using Oculus Link and reaching 120Hz, consider the following hardware configurations:
- Ensure a Powerful GPU: A powerful graphics card is crucial. Aim for a GPU comparable to the NVIDIA RTX 3060 or higher to handle the demands of VR at 120Hz.
- High-Quality USB-C Cable: If using wired Oculus Link, invest in a high-quality USB-C cable to minimize latency and ensure a stable connection.

Will enabling 120Hz affect my headset’s battery life?
Enabling the 120Hz refresh rate on your Oculus headset may potentially impact battery life. The higher refresh rate requires more processing power and can put additional strain on the headset’s hardware. This means that while you can enjoy a smoother experience, it may lead to quicker battery depletion during use compared to running at lower refresh rates.
To manage battery consumption effectively, you can consider adjusting other settings such as screen brightness or turning off background applications not in use. Keeping your headset charged and taking regular breaks during extensive VR sessions can also help mitigate any impacts of battery life while enjoying the enhanced experience provided by 120Hz.

Is there any downside to using 120Hz in VR?
While the advantages of using 120Hz in VR are significant, there are also some potential downsides to consider. One of the primary concerns is the increased demand on your hardware, which may lead to overheating or performance throttling if your system is not adequately equipped. This could potentially counteract the benefits of a higher refresh rate if the frame rates drop unexpectedly.
Moreover, some users may notice that not all experiences benefit equally from the higher refresh rate. In certain scenarios, the visual improvements might not be as apparent, particularly if the game itself is not optimized for that setting. Therefore, it’s important to select experiences specifically designed for 120Hz to maximize your enjoyment and performance in VR.
